Transaction 18fc434c6e30a331e6f385e33e30dc19b7827b80b81ac232c08767e549fa68a3
1 Input
1 Output
-
18fc434c6e30a331e6f385e33e30dc19b7827b80b81ac232c08767e549fa68a3:0
- value
- 310861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b87a45965c1c1fa33518c1e9a97c4f9ce9f3be2 OP_EQUAL
- address
- 3BVaie61C8yzcRqofBBJkj4WF943bbnFS8